Rifle Project X Wins Australian PGA

TORRINGTON, Conn. — Winning for the second consecutive week Down Under, premium Rifle® Project X steel shafts out-scored the competition and delivered victory at the Australian PGA Championship. The win was the champion’s third Australian PGA title since 2000.

Winning the Australian PGA and the Australian Open in back-to-back weeks tops off a fantastic year for premium Rifle steel shafts, which claimed dozens of victories on the professional tours and which are today used by Three of the Top Five ranked golfers in the world.

"Rifle Project X continues to prove its exceptional consistency and accuracy among the best players in the world, and we are excited to see Project X once again demonstrate why it is considered the world’s most advanced steel shaft," says Ray Lucas, senior vice president of sales and marketing for Royal Precision. "Often praised for its innovative and patented design, the Rifle Project X shaft helps players maintain their highest level of consistency by using a different per-inch constant taper that provides greater energy transfer to the ball at impact and optimum trajectory."

Rifle steel shafts are often considered the world’s most advanced steel shaft because the shaft design incorporates four unique technologies which provide unparalleled performance and consistency. Only Rifle steel shafts offer: Frequency Matching that perfectly matches a set of clubs through electronic calibration; Stepless Design Technology that eliminates the energy-robbing ‘steps’ found on most other steel shafts, and provides greater accuracy and a smooth, yet solid, feel at impact; Patented Internal ‘Rifling’ that transfers energy more efficiently, reduces vibration and increases distance; and advanced Flighted Technology that produces variable ball trajectories for different clubs within a single set.

During the 2005 PGA Tour season, the Rifle Project X shafts have won Mercedes Championships, FBR Phoenix Open, AT&T Pebble Beach, WCG Match Play Championship, Bell South Classic and the PGA Championship.
